Ombudsman met with civil society organisation’s representatives

30/07/2021

Pristina, 29 July 2021 – The Ombudsperson, Mr. Naim Qelaj met on Thursday the representatives of non-governmental organizations that deal with activities dedicated to people with disabilities.

They discussed about the work and activities of the organisations for the blind, deaf, children with autism and Down syndrome, and in particular about the problems they encounter in their work.
Mr. Qelaj said that the work of civil society organizations is important and vital for a democratic society which are drivers for the improvement and promotion of human rights in the country.
The Ombudsperson also praised the commitment of the emigrants and their contribution given to people with disabilities, emphasizing the work of Mrs. Shqipe Kryeziu, as a representative of an association in Switzerland that has brought a lot of help to this community.
